The buzz about BFusion/BFlex ‘08 has not subsided. We had a great conference this year and the idea is catching on. At Adobe MAX NA this year it was mention by Kristen Schofield, ColdFusion Senior Product Marketing Manager, the Adobe Community team and the Adobe Education team as a model for helping introduce new developers to ColdFusion, Flex and AIR. Each group confirmed their ongoing support for the conference and were anxious to get planning next year’s conference.
The most that I can say about BFusion/BFlex ‘09 at this time is that we are are committed to making it happen. We got a lot of positive feedback and some excellent suggestions on how to improve the event. It is too early to determine exact dates, but the plan is for fall. Since Adobe MAX NA will be much earlier next year (October 4-7 in Los Angeles) it will impact our planning. We also have to wait to see when we can secure our facilities. Academic uses take precedence.
